RECCER'S NOTES: Sapphire and Steel is the most beautifully weird TV show I have ever encountered (as one TV guidebook described it: “There are many ways of holding a TV audience... Total lack of explanation is not supposed to be one of them.”) and also one of the most interesting fandoms for fic, as authors each try in their own way to interpret those mysteries and transpose that sense of otherness in the mundane to their writing, and nobody does it quite the same way, so I’m hoping to rec some more S&S before I’m done here.

Anyway, this fic one of the best examples - it’s marvellous, long, plotty, completely true to canon-weirdness (if you can say such a thing) and sharply characterised, with every bit of Sapphire-Steel-Silver interaction a delight. Plus – always a huge bonus for me – not only does it include Silver but it brings in some additional ‘operators’ from the opening credits, and explores just how strange they might be. And if you don’t know the series, but you like exploring the weirdness of time or enjoy ghost stories, why not give it a try? It’s a glorious fic and you really won’t know any less than those of us who have watched the canon, honest…

RECCER'S NOTES: Star Trek has so many alien races yet so little fanfiction tries to understand an alien perspective. This short piece, written for the Rarewomen exchange, explores Guinan's perception of the universe via her relationship with another outsider, Ro Laren. Killer Quean comes up with an interesting possible answer to the question of what friendship might mean to a being who perceives alternate timelines. The piece's three parts overlay each other, using repetition to underscore the differences & similarities between the timelines. The final part is particularly strong, with the best description of assimilation I've read.
